Utility Tariff Database FAQs

1. What is a utility tariff database?

A utility tariff database is a digital resource that compiles electric and natural gas tariffs from utilities and state regulators. It provides easy access to current and historical rate schedules, cost components, and pricing structures to help businesses analyze and manage energy costs effectively.

2. How can a utility tariff database help my business?

By using a utility tariff database, businesses can quickly identify cost-saving opportunities, compare rates across different utilities, and make informed energy procurement decisions. It also aids in budgeting, forecasting, and optimizing energy usage based on time-of-use rates and demand charges. One major advantage of using a database rather than performing searches manually is time savings.

3. What types of tariffs are included in a utility tariff database?

Most databases include standard energy rates, demand charges, time-of-use pricing, seasonal variations, fuel cost adjustments, and various riders. They cover both residential and commercial tariffs, helping businesses assess rate structures and their potential impact on costs.

4. Does the database cover both electric and natural gas tariffs?

Yes, many utility tariff databases provide comprehensive coverage of electric and natural gas tariffs from utilities across multiple regions. This allows businesses to analyze and compare costs for both energy sources efficiently.

23. How does a database compare to public utility commission (PUC) filings?

A utility tariff database provides structured, searchable data that is easier to access and analyze compared to raw PUC filings, which often require extensive manual research.

24. Does a database include transmission and distribution charges?

Yes, most databases provide detailed cost breakdowns, including transmission, distribution and other delivery charges.
